5) Special Conditions of Use
When used for a Group III application, the surface of the
enclosure may store electrostatic charge and become a
source of ignition in applications with a low relative humidity
<~30% relative humidity where the surface is relatively free of
surface contamination such as dirt, dust, or oil.
Guidance on protection against the risk of ignition due to
electrostatic discharge can be found in EN TR50404 and IEC
TR60079-32.
End user shall adhere to the manufacturer’s installation and
instruction when performing housekeeping to avoid the
potential for hazardous electrostatic charges during cleaning,
by using a damp cloth.
To maintain the ingress protection rating and mode of
protection, the cable entries must be fitted with suitably rated,
certified cable entry and/or blanking devices during
installation.
The equipment incorporates metal parts isolated from earth,
having capacitance values exceeding the limits permitted in
the standards of certification. Mounting bracket – 10.33pF;
Lens guard – 12.33pF.
The equipment shall only be used in an area of at least
pollution degree 2, as defined in IEC 60664-1.
6) Production Location and Access
6.1.
Location and Mounting
The location of the beacon should be made with due regard
to the area over which the warning signal must be audible.
They should only be fixed to services that can carry the
weight of the unit.
The E2x beacon should be secured to any flat surface using
the three 7mm fixing holes on the stainless steel U shaped
mounting bracket. See Figure 1. The required angle can be
achieved by loosening the two large bracket screws in the
side of the unit, which allow adjustment of the beacon in
steps of 18°. On completion of the installation the two large
bracket adjustment screws on the side of the unit must be
fully tightened to ensure that the unit cannot move in service.

6.2.
Access to the Enclosure
Warning – High voltage may be
present, risk of electric shock.
DO NOT open when energised,
disconnect power before opening.
Warning – Hot surfaces. External
surfaces and internal components
may be hot after operation, take
care when handling the equipment.
To access the enclosure, remove the four M4 posi pan head
screws, M4 spring and plain washers and withdraw the cover.
Fig. 2 Accessing the Enclosure.
To replace cover, check that the ‘O’ ring seal is in place.
Carefully push the cover in place. Insert and tighten down M4
screws, spring and plain washers in the order shown above
and tighten down.
7) Selection of Cable. Cable Glands, Blanking
Elements & Adapters
When selecting the cable size, consideration must be given
to the input current that each unit draws (see Table 1), the
number of sounders on the line and the length of the cable
runs. The cable size selected must have the necessary
capacity to provide the input current to all of the sounders
connected to the line.
The dual entries can be ordered with one of the following
options:
2-off M20 x 1.5 thread
2-off ½” NPT thread
1-off M20 x 1.5 & 1-off ½” NPT thread
To maintain the ingress protection rating and mode of
protection, the cable entries must be fitted with suitably rated,
certified cable entry and/or blanking devices during
installation.
For ambient temperatures over +40ºC the cable entry
temperature may exceed +70ºC or the cable branching
temperature may exceed +80ºC. Therefore suitable heat
resisting cables and cable glands must be used as per table
below
